Believe it or not, the beans in this picture were kept in an upcycled small juice container as an improvised baby toy for the past four years. My kids never thought to open the container! We had some friends we don’t see very often over last month, and they were the ones who figured out that the top came off!
So, one of my most popular baby toys ever (seriously) was gone, but the beans found a new use occupying Johnny. He spent a good half hour sorting and counting beans. Then Emma came over and they both got silly and dumped everything out on the floor…
